I think the answer is no, but can anyone tell me if postgresql supports the older (pre sql-92?) style outer join syntax, eg:
SELECT *
FROM a,b
WHERE a.pk *= b.fk
It doesn't appear to support that exact syntax, which suggests it
doesn't know what I'm talking about, but maybe there's a system option
to turn it on???
